- His death at 87, reported Saturday by the Stratford-Upon-Avon Herald, was widely confirmed by major outlets, and no cause was disclosed.
- He reached his widest TV audience as John Greer, the calculating antagonist on CBS’s Person of Interest, joining in Season 2 and staying through the 2016 finale.
- He appeared in several of Christopher Nolan’s films, playing Wayne Enterprises board member Douglas Fredericks in Batman Begins and The Dark Knight Rises, with additional roles in Following and Dunkirk.
- He trained at Drama Centre London and built a classical stage career with the Royal Shakespeare Company and the National Theatre after early TV leads in Daniel Deronda and Doomwatch.
- He is survived by his wife, actress Kim Hartman, their children Miranda and Tom, and grandchildren Dylan and Kara, and Hartman praised him as a “free spirit” in a public tribute.
